Energy storage RS485 communication method - Inner Mongolia Dengkou 605MW1410MWh Electric Energy Storage New Energy Project

The total investment of the Dengkou Electric Energy Storage New Energy Project in Inner Mongolia is 2.137 billion yuan. This phase plans to build an electrochemical energy storage power station with a capacity of 605MW/1410MWh, which is an important part of the future construction of a new power system. This project adopts an innovative flow energy storage system, which plays a significant role in addressing the consumption of new energy, enhancing the flexibility of the power system, and improving the safe and stable operation of the power grid. It is of great significance to the economic and social development of the region.

Gas detection system solutions

Application sites

  • Battery production workshop

    The preparation and liquid injection processes of positive and negative electrode materials for lithium batteries may come into contact with organic solvents (such as dimethyl carbonate), and the concentration of flammable gases needs to be monitored near the coating machine and liquid injection equipment.

  • Electric vehicle charging station

    If there are vehicles with faulty batteries near the charging piles, flammable gases may be released. Detectors should be deployed in the charging Spaces and distribution rooms to ensure the safety of personnel.

  • Hydrogen refueling station

    Explosion-proof detectors should be installed in areas such as hydrogen refueling machines and hydrogen storage cylinder groups to link with emergency shut-off valves to prevent hydrogen leakage from causing explosions.

  • Hydrogen production/storage sites

    Hydrogen leakage is prone to occur in electrolytic water hydrogen production workshops and high-pressure hydrogen storage tank areas. High-sensitivity alarms should be installed at pipe joints and valves, with the threshold set at 10% to 25% of the lower explosive limit (4%).
